Deceuninck Parts Ways with Alpecin-Deceuninck and Fenix-Deceuninck Teams, Ending Title Sponsorship

Deceuninck Parts Ways with Alpecin-Deceuninck and Fenix-Deceuninck Teams, Ending Title Sponsorship
Share
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est Email Tumblr Reddit VKontakte Telegram WhatsApp Copy Link

In a significant shift within the world of professional cycling, Deceuninck has announced its decision to step away from its title sponsorship roles with two prominent teams, Alpecin-Deceuninck and Fenix-Deceuninck. This decision marks the end of a key chapter for both teams, which have consistently competed at the highest levels of the sport. The announcement comes as the cycling community prepares for a pivotal season, with questions arising regarding the implications of this change for the teams’ future prospects and sponsorship landscape. As Deceuninck transitions away from its longstanding commitment, the cycling world watches closely to see how Alpecin-Deceuninck and Fenix-Deceuninck will navigate this new era.

Deceuninck Ends Title Sponsorship with Alpecin-Deceuninck and Fenix-Deceuninck

In a surprising turn of events, Deceuninck has officially announced its decision to terminate its title sponsorship with both Alpecin-Deceuninck and Fenix-Deceuninck teams. This move marks the end of a fruitful partnership that has seen notable achievements and growth within the cycling community. The sponsorship, which began with the aim of promoting innovative products and enhancing brand visibility, has served as a robust platform for both teams to excel on the world stage.

The announcement has raised questions among fans and stakeholders alike regarding the future of these prominent teams. Deceuninck’s departure from title sponsorship may lead to shifts in team dynamics and funding. Key aspects to consider moving forward include:

  • Team Funding: The impact on financial stability and sponsorship acquisition.
  • Brand Identity: How the teams will evolve their brand presence without Deceuninck’s backing.
  • Future Partnerships: Potential new sponsors that could fill the void left by Deceuninck.
